Engine oil level indicator

System which informs the driver whether
the engine oil level is correct or not.
This information is indicated for a few seconds
when the ignition is switched on, after the
service information.
The level read will only be correct
if the vehicle is on level ground and
the engine has been off for more than
30 minutes.
Oil level correct
This is indicated by a message in
the instrument panel screen.
Oil level incorrect
This is indicated by a message in
the instrument panel screen.
If the low oil level is confirmed by a check
using the dipstick, the level must be topped up
to avoid damage to the engine.
Oil level indicator fault
This is indicated by a message in
the instrument panel screen. Contact
a CITROËN dealer or a qualified workshop.
Dipstick
Refer to the "Checks" section to locate the
dipstick and the oil filler cap on your engine.
There are 2 marks on the dipstick:
-
A = max; never exceed this
level,
-
B = min; top up the level via
the oil filler cap, using the
grade of oil suited to your
engine.
